the one in boston is better


The famous New York Public Library is  impressive, but from a functional and stylistic perspective I think that Boston ended up with a much better building. The architects went mad with staircases, and my efforts to find a bathroom were thwarted. As I understand it, the book storage and delivery system is absurd, and although much criticism has been raised against the planned renovations, any change would be an improvement.
